日期:2014-05-19  浏览次数:20908 次

我的SQL语句写的对吗?为什么总提示我FROM子句语法错误??
protected   void   LogButton_Click(object   sender,   EventArgs   e)
        {
                string   userid,   pwd;
                userid   =   Userid.Text;
                pwd   =   Pwd.Text;
                string   mySel   =   "select   count(*)   as   iCount   from   user   where   Userid= "   +   " ' "   +   userid   +   " '; ";

                OleDbCommand   myCmd1   =   new   OleDbCommand(mySel,myConn);
                myCmd1.Connection.Open();
                OleDbDataReader   Dr1;
                Dr1   =   myCmd1.ExecuteReader();
                Dr1.Read();
                string   count   =   Dr1[ "iCount "].ToString();
                Dr1.Close();
                myCmd1.Connection.Close();
                string   drPwd;
                if   (count   !=   "0 ")
                {
                        mySel   =   "select   *   from   user   where   Userid= "   +   " ' "   +   userid   +   " '; ";
                        OleDbCommand   myCmd   =   new   OleDbCommand(mySel,   myConn);
                        myCmd.Connection.Open();
                        OleDbDataReader   myDr   =   myCmd.ExecuteReader();
                        myDr.Read();
                        drPwd   =   myDr[ "password "].ToString();
                        myDr.Close();
                        myCmd.Connection.Close();
                        if   (drPwd   ==   pwd)
                        {
                                Session[ "loginID "]   =   userid;
                                Response.Redirect( "main.aspx ");
                        }
                        else